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
a total rewards program
Encompasses all forms of compensation, including salary, benefits, and other perks.
a remuneration package
Replaces "compensation system" with a focus on the total value of salary and benefits.
a pay structure
Focuses specifically on the arrangement of salary levels within an organization.
a salary framework
Similar to pay structure, emphasizes the systematic approach to determining salaries.
a benefits program
Highlights the non-salary components of compensation, such as health insurance and retirement plans.
a reward scheme
Emphasizes incentives and bonuses as part of the overall compensation strategy.
an incentive plan
Focuses on performance-based rewards designed to motivate employees.
a wage system
Specifically refers to the method of paying employees, often hourly or salaried.
a commission structure
Relates to how sales staff or other roles are paid based on sales or performance metrics.
a reimbursement policy
Deals with the guidelines and procedures for repaying employees for expenses.
FAQs
What are the key components of "a compensation system"?
A comprehensive "compensation system" typically includes base salary, variable pay (bonuses or commissions), benefits (health insurance, retirement plans), and perquisites (additional perks). The specific mix depends on the industry, company size, and job roles.
What can I say instead of "a compensation system"?
You can use alternatives like "a remuneration package", "a pay structure", or "a total rewards program", depending on the context.
How does "a compensation system" impact employee performance?
A well-designed "compensation system" can significantly boost employee performance by aligning rewards with desired outcomes, motivating employees to achieve goals, and attracting/retaining top talent. Conversely, a poorly designed system can lead to dissatisfaction and decreased productivity.
What are the legal considerations when designing "a compensation system"?
Legal considerations include ensuring compliance with minimum wage laws, equal pay regulations (preventing gender or racial pay gaps), overtime rules, and tax laws. Employers must also be mindful of contractual obligations and potential discrimination claims.
